We Built This Wall for Birds — Here’s What Happened


In April, we joined a group of volunteers on a small island in the Drava River, Slovenia — and built a sand wall by hand. Why? Because Sand Martins, a small migratory bird, had lost their natural nesting sites. Dams and hydropower reduced the river’s flow so much, sandbanks stopped forming naturally.

So we decided to act.

In this video, we return two months later to see if our effort worked — and what we found left us speechless.
